Output 53bc4bee899d87b58b6f105cf9a43dab83453915162f863b744b6f1d986d23df:2

value
307350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dbd6db5b59abf5cc9b123be5577a9c217ff0a18 OP_EQUAL
address
3LSsNbW3NnSXjCrkfPyJu7XEew3B7UgggD
transaction
53bc4bee899d87b58b6f105cf9a43dab83453915162f863b744b6f1d986d23df
spent
true